Georgia Binderim

November 19, 1931 — April 1, 2012

Georgia Rose Binderim, 80, of Perry, Oklahoma, was the daughter of Nelson I. and Clara M. Schmidt Smith. She was born on November 19, 1931 in Zenda, Kansas and died Sunday, April 1, 2012 at Perry Memorial Hospital. She graduated from Valley Center High School in 1949. Georgia had been a resident of Perry, Oklahoma for twentytwo years. She was a member of the Church of the Resurrection in Wichita, Kansas. She enjoyed playing dominos, reading, ceramics and antiques but most of all she enjoyed spending time with her children and grandchildren. Georgia will be remembered as a loving mother, sister, grandmother and great grandmother by all that knew her.
